C9CMS PHP源码utf-8测试版特性与应用
版权申诉
36 浏览量
更新于2024-10-14
收藏 1.1MB ZIP 举报
资源摘要信息:"PHP实例开发源码——C9CMS utf-8 测试版.zip"
知识点说明:
1. PHP编程语言基础: PHP是一种广泛使用的开源服务器端脚本语言,主要用于网页开发,能够嵌入到HTML中。C9CMS作为基于PHP开发的管理系统,利用了PHP的高级特性,如动态内容生成、数据库交互、会话管理等。
2. CMS系统概念: CMS全称为内容管理系统(Content Management System),是一种用来协助用户管理网站或网页、数据库等的软件。CMS系统通常用于管理、发布、归档以及修改网站内容,且能通过插件或模块的形式进行功能扩展。
3. utf-8编码介绍: utf-8是一种针对Unicode的可变长度字符编码,可以用来表示Unicode标准中的任何字符,并且是最广泛使用的Unicode编码。在Web开发中,utf-8编码因其对多语言的广泛支持而成为常用的网页字符编码,能够正确显示包括中文在内的各种语言文字。
4. 版本控制与测试版的意义: 测试版通常指软件在正式发布前的一个版本,用于测试软件的功能、性能、稳定性等,以便于发现并修复潜在的问题。版本控制是管理软件源代码变更历史的过程,常使用版本控制工具如Git、SVN等,确保软件开发的各个阶段都可追踪、复原和管理。
5. 文件压缩和解压缩: 压缩文件是一种将多个文件或文件夹压缩成一个单一文件的过程,常用格式有.zip、.rar等。压缩文件可以减少存储空间的占用、便于文件的传输和备份。解压缩则是将压缩文件还原成原始文件的过程。
6. 开源项目的意义: 开源意味着软件的源代码对所有人开放,可以在遵守相应的开源许可协议下,自由地使用、修改和分发。开源项目鼓励社区参与,提高软件的透明度和可靠性,同时还能带动技术的交流和进步。
7. 软件开发流程和规范: 软件开发流程通常包括需求分析、设计、编码、测试、部署和维护等多个阶段。而在开发中还需要遵守代码规范和标准,以提高代码的可读性和可维护性。C9CMS作为一款开源项目,其源码应该是遵循了良好的开发规范和文档编写。
8. 软件测试的要点: 软件测试是指对软件产品的功能、性能等各方面进行检查和验证的过程,以确保软件产品的质量和可靠性。测试要点包括功能测试、界面测试、性能测试、兼容性测试、安全测试等。
9. 使用PHP实例学习和开发: 利用PHP开发实例,如C9CMS,是学习PHP编程和Web开发的一个非常有效的方法。通过分析和修改实例代码,可以加深对PHP语言的理解和应用,对实际开发有很好的实践意义。
10. 软件维护和更新: 软件发布后,开发者需要根据用户反馈和技术更新,定期进行软件的维护和更新工作,以增加新功能、修复漏洞和提高性能。
由于文件名称列表“***”没有提供具体文件内容信息,无法直接从中提取相关知识点。不过,如果该数字序列代表文件在特定版本控制下的标识,那么可以推测文件可能是特定版本控制系统的版本号或提交ID,用于追踪和标识特定版本或提交的源码。
2019-07-07 上传
2019-10-17 上传
2019-07-06 上传
2022-11-14 上传
2023-07-02 上传
2023-07-02 上传
2023-07-02 上传
2023-07-02 上传
易小侠
- 粉丝: 6592
- 资源: 9万+
最新资源
- 探索数据转换实验平台在设备装置中的应用
- 使用git-log-to-tikz.py将Git日志转换为TIKZ图形
- 小栗子源码2.9.3版本发布
- 使用Tinder-Hack-Client实现Tinder API交互
- Android Studio新模板:个性化Material Design导航抽屉
- React API分页模块:数据获取与页面管理
- C语言实现顺序表的动态分配方法
- 光催化分解水产氢固溶体催化剂制备技术揭秘
- VS2013环境下tinyxml库的32位与64位编译指南
- 网易云歌词情感分析系统实现与架构
- React应用展示GitHub用户详细信息及项目分析
- LayUI2.1.6帮助文档API功能详解
- 全栈开发实现的chatgpt应用可打包小程序/H5/App
- C++实现顺序表的动态内存分配技术
- Java制作水果格斗游戏:策略与随机性的结合
- 基于若依框架的后台管理系统开发实例解析